I've raised this as an issue with the VSTS team, both in the forums as
well as formally. Here is the forum post:

http://forums.microsoft.com/MSDN/ShowPost.aspx?PostID=773869&SiteID=1

 

For the time being (until a better solution is available) I've been
branching the files into the different build types. That way if there is
a change I can change them in the master build type and then just merge
the changes into the branches.

I'm working at converting a bunch of msbuild files to TFS. We have a set
of custom made tasks files and properties plus several .proj files that
we import into multiple build files to share a large set of targets.

How can I do this in TFS Builds?

 

First I tried to copy the common files into a separate folder in the
\TeamBuildTypes\Shared\ and do a custom get of the files out of TFS as
part of the BeforeEndToEndIteration in the TFSBuild.proj.

However I cannot import the files in the TFSBuild in order to give them
control when I want because the files don't exist when the main proj
file is loaded.

 

I can execute the targets in them using MSBuild but I don't really want
to do that. I would actually like to have defined in them tasks like
BeforeClean and BeforeGet that would get merged/overwritten in the main
TFS. 

It would work as expected if I would save all the files in the same
folder as the TFSBuild.proj but this is not really an option as I would
duplicate lots of code.

 

Any ideas/recommendations/advice about how to do this?

(My main build file is about 2000 lines and I need to create 3 build
types that would share about 80% of the functionality from the main
build file.)
